The Beauty And Versatility Of Etched Aluminum

etched aluminum is a versatile material that has gained popularity in various industries due to its unique properties and aesthetic appeal. This process involves using chemicals or a laser to create designs, patterns, or text on the surface of the aluminum. The result is a durable and corrosion-resistant material that is ideal for a wide range of applications.

One of the key benefits of etched aluminum is its durability. The process of etching creates a layer of oxide on the surface of the aluminum, which helps protect it from corrosion and wear. This makes etched aluminum an excellent choice for outdoor applications, such as signage, nameplates, and decorative panels. The etched designs are also resistant to fading and scratching, ensuring that they will remain vibrant and clear for years to come.

One of the most common uses of etched aluminum is in signage and nameplates. The process allows for logos, text, and other information to be permanently etched onto the surface of the aluminum, creating a professional and polished look. Etched aluminum signage is ideal for businesses, schools, hospitals, and other public spaces where durability and visibility are important. The etched designs can be filled with color to enhance visibility or left as is for a more subtle and sophisticated look.

Etched aluminum is also widely used in the manufacturing industry for labeling and identification purposes. The etched designs can include serial numbers, barcodes, and other information that is essential for tracking and inventory management. Etched aluminum nameplates and labels are durable and long-lasting, making them ideal for use in harsh environments or industrial settings. The etched designs can withstand high temperatures, chemicals, and abrasion, ensuring that they will remain legible and intact even under the most demanding conditions.
